Just got a 2005 zx6r. Overall a great bike and only 7000km. Doing some work soon it to get it ready for spring. Took all the fairings off and noticed some type of weld/gasket repair to the lower half of the block. IS this a good repair, should I be concerned or off loading this bike ASAP???:|
Is that the bottom front of timing/pickup cover ? Need to zoom out. Looks like Jbweld or simler needs to come off to check whats happened underneath might just be the cover if your lucky.
it looks to me like someone had either ran it over something or crashed into something or jumped a curb or in some fashion they have broken the pan and part of the lower case........
replaced the pan and put something like liquid steel on the lower case half and then there is some silicon over the joint, and that bolt is missing
but...........the pictures leave a little to be desired
As far as "is this a good fix or not"................without atleast pulling the silicone off and removing the oil pan and looking in there to see- I cannot tell you........ I can say- that part of the cases is not load bearing, so stresses would be low, the oil pan not having all the bolts installed though could be an issue with leakage........possibly thus the silicone

Yep.....Ignition rotor/pick up cover
So......... I would want to see inside it, the cam chain guides attach in there and the crank end, igniiton rotor and puck up coil all attach too.......... while it may not be leaking, I would want to first hand what it all looks like inside before trusting it.......sure it runs and apparently does not leak, but..............
